## Local setup — Inkpress renderer

Clone the repo, install deps, and run `make fonts` to pull the Calverton font pack. The renderer needs the invoice metadata DB running locally; use the seed script to load sample invoices. Start the worker with `make dev`. Point your local instance at the connection string below.

replica DSN, kajep-yahag: mssql://praok_svc:iF@db-8d68.plorvaio.local:5432/eliion

☐ Step 7 — Thumbnail queue custody. Before sealing the Briskwave signing keys, confirm the thumbnail generation queue (ThumbForge) has been drained and paused, so no jobs hold stale credentials during the ceremony. New members: verify the pause flag in the ops console, then countersign the log sheet. The recovery passphrase for the queue's encrypted config follows below.

unlock words, tawif-tahop: oliys-ulawyn-tamdor-lamys-casox-jormir-fraius-kasath-ulador-ulamir-holir-sorys-holeth

## Local Setup

PedalShift is our rebalancing planner for the Windmere bike-share network. Before running the optimizer locally, install the dependencies with `make deps` and start the docking-station simulator with `make sim`. The planner expects a seeded database containing station capacities and historical trip counts; run `make seed` to populate it, which takes about two minutes. Once seeding finishes, configure your local environment to reach the database using the connection string below.

replica DSN, yahaf-yagaf: mongodb://tamath_svc:a2netSk3RZMuTj@db-d084.novacsoft.internal:5432/ralmir